- The distance between Lampang, Thailand and San Luis Obispo, Ca, Usa is approximately 12,710 km or 7,898 mi.
- To reach Lampang in this distance one would set out from San Luis Obispo, Ca bearing 317.4°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Lampang bearing 215.7° or SW .
- Lampang has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as San Luis Obispo, Ca has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Lampang is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as San Luis Obispo, Ca is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 10.9 °C (19.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1 °C (1.8°F) more in Lampang.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 481.1 mm (18.9 in) more which is equivalent to 481.1 l/m² (11.81 US gal/ft²) or 4,811,000 l/ha (514,328 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.1° higher in Lampang than in San Luis Obispo, Ca.
